AI Analysis

LEGO Frozen Northern Lights functions as a character-driven expansion of an existing franchise. It succeeds in presenting strong female protagonists who act as the primary architects of their own adventure, effectively disrupting traditional gender hierarchies through Elsa and Anna's agency. However, the production remains tethered to the established visual and social norms of the original property. This results in a lack of intersectional complexity, as the casting and cultural frameworks stay within conventional Western storytelling boundaries. While the film provides meaningful representation for female characters, it lacks the breadth of racial or identity-based diversity needed to move beyond a moderate score.
